You can determine if your lawn in Vanderwagen needs dethatching by checking for a thick layer of thatch, usually more than half an inch. Signs that indicate the need for dethatching include poor water absorption, areas of brown or unhealthy grass, and a spongy feel when walking on the lawn. If you notice that your grass struggles to recover after mowing or watering, it may also be a sign of excessive thatch. Conducting a simple test by pulling back a section of grass to assess the thickness of the thatch layer can help you identify whether dethatching is necessary. Lawn dethatching is the process of removing a layer of thatch, a buildup of dead grass, roots, and organic matter that can accumulate on the soil surface. In Vanderwagen, dethatching is necessary because excessive thatch can impede water, nutrients, and air from reaching the grass roots, leading to a weak and unhealthy lawn. Regular dethatching helps promote healthy growth, improves drainage, and enhances overall lawn vitality. It is typically performed during the growing season when the grass is actively growing and can recover quickly. After dethatching your lawn in Vanderwagen, there are several important steps to follow to promote recovery and health. First, it's advisable to leave the dethatched material on the lawn, as it will break down and return valuable nutrients to the soil. Next, watering your lawn thoroughly is crucial to help the grass recover from the stress of dethatching. Applying a light layer of fertilizer can provide additional nutrients, further enhancing recovery. Avoid heavy foot traffic for a few weeks to allow the grass to regrow. Regular maintenance, such as mowing and watering, will ensure that your lawn remains lush and healthy following dethatching.
The best time to dethatch your lawn in Vanderwagen typically depends on the type of grass you have. For cool-season grasses, early spring or early fall is ideal, as these times align with the grass's active growth phase, allowing it to recover quickly. Warm-season grasses, on the other hand, should be dethatched in late spring to early summer when they are also in their peak growth period. Avoid dethatching during extreme heat or drought, as this can stress the grass. Proper timing is crucial to ensure your lawn can bounce back effectively after the dethatching process.
